Description
Overview
Bruker is one of the world’s leading analytical instrumentation companies enabling scientist to make breakthrough discoveries and develop new application that improve the quality of human life. Our high-performance products and high-value life science and diagnostic solutions are trusted by leading businesses, institutes, and scientists worldwide. Today, more than 8,500 employees at over 90 locations are working on this permanent challenge to make the world a better place.
Manufacturing Technician at Micro Star Technologies (MST) facility in Huntsville, TX (https://microstartech.com/nano-indenters-diamond-knives/)
Responsibilities
Sharpen, cut and/or mount diamond products to required specifications
Operate various machines and instruments used in the manufacturing process
Organize, coordinate, and perform all assigned in-house assembly and testing for manufacturing of products
Track and report on real time production progress against production schedules
Build and qualify parts and assemblies
Document and provide timely feedback to management on issues encountered during build processes
Organize and track all part inspection and non-conformance issues for assigned work
Document manufacturing procedures upon request
Support of quality and engineering through troubleshooting issues
Perform routine maintenance of machines used in production
Requires occasional evening, off shift and weekend work to meet production schedules
Perform other duties as requested
ENVIRONMENTAL REQUIREMENTS:
None
Qualifications
K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ES:
Good hand eye coordination
Fine motor skills
Knowledge of metal machining or electronics repair a plus
Experience working under microscopy
Basic computer skills - Data Entry, MS Office, etc.
Good organizational skills – Will need to sharpen and track multiple tips simultaneously
EDUCATIONAL/EXPERIENCE REQUIREMENTS:
High School education or higher with experience
